Lawmakers on the New Mexico Finance Authority Oversight Committee voted 6-5 to derail a finance authority oversight proposal to utilize unused millions from a longstanding Economic Development Revolving Fund program to make the loans. A proposal to offer up to $5 million in loans to assist cannabis microbusiness operators failed to realize traction in a legislative committee listening to Thursday after some lawmakers stated there weren’t enough particulars to warrant support. Check out ourGrassroots Guideto be taught extra about how this program works. Since 1998, NMAA has been at the forefront of providing help and advocacy for acequia communities. In the previous eighteen years, NMAA has expanded tremendously and now provides quite a lot of companies to farmers and ranchers across the state. For example, through their Acequia Governance Program, NMAA has labored with nearly 400 particular person acequias in New Mexico with the objective of ensuring that water rights remain connected to the land by way of steady agricultural manufacturing. USDA is financing $129 million of these investments via the Rural Energy for America Program. This program offers funding to help agricultural producers and rural small businesses buy and install renewable vitality methods and make power efficiency enhancements. These climate-smart investments will preserve and generate greater than 379 million kilowatt-hours in rural America, which equates to enough electricity to power 35,677 houses per year.

Data included is taken from the Minnesota Department of Health Daily stories. Because all knowledge is preliminary, the change in variety of cumulative optimistic cases and deaths from in the future to the following may not equal the newly reported instances or deaths.



In addition, the applicant’s household earnings should not exceed 100 percent of the median non-metropolitan household earnings for the state during which the applicant resides. The 2017 Non-Metropolitan median household earnings is $52,300 for New Mexico. The income standards apply to each the applicant and all different occupants of the house.

Total bankruptcies filed by state range considerably, from no bankruptcies in some states to as many as forty five filings in others, as proven in Figure 2. Oregon, Nevada, New Mexico, New Jersey, Rhode Island and Delaware had no Chapter 12 bankruptcies filed in the past 12 months, based on knowledge from the united states These states have constantly seen low numbers of bankruptcies in the past decade.
